Step 1: Evaluating Regional Environmental Threats

Successful design begins with a thorough assessment of the local climate and its impact on various building materials. Professionals look at historical weather patterns, including average rainfall, wind speeds, and UV exposure levels, to determine which materials will degrade fastest. A roof in a coastal area faces salt spray and humidity, whereas a roof in a mountainous region must handle heavy snow loads and freeze-thaw cycles. By identifying these threats early, experts can select a material palette that resists local stressors, ensuring the visual appeal does not fade after just a few seasons of harsh weather.

Step 3: Prioritizing the Invisible Infrastructure

Durability is often hidden beneath the surface of the shingles or tiles in the form of underlayment and flashing. Experts install high-temperature ice and water shields in vulnerable areas like valleys, chimneys, and skylights to prevent leaks during winter storms. Proper ventilation is another invisible factor that protects the roof from the inside out by regulating attic temperatures and preventing moisture buildup. Neglecting these internal components leads to premature failure, regardless of how expensive or beautiful the outer layer appears. A well-engineered system ensures that the aesthetic finish remains supported by a dry, stable deck for its entire lifespan.

Step 4: Implementing Precision Installation Techniques

Craftsmanship during the installation phase dictates whether a roof will meet its expected lifespan or fail early. Experts follow strict fastening patterns, using the correct number and type of nails or clips for the specific material being applied. Metal roofs require specialized expansion and contraction fasteners to prevent buckling during temperature shifts, while slate requires careful hand-fitting to avoid breakage. Professional crews maintain clean lines and tight seams, which are essential for both the waterproof integrity and the final visual quality of the project. Attention to detail at this stage prevents small gaps that could allow wind-driven rain to enter the home.

Innovative Solutions for Modern Homes

Modern architecture often demands minimalist profiles that are notoriously difficult to waterproof using traditional methods. Experts utilize new technologies and installation methods to meet these high-design standards without risking leaks or structural rot.

  • Standing Seam Integration: Hidden fasteners allow for a smooth, continuous metal surface that provides a modern look and total moisture protection.
  • Reflective Coatings: Specialists apply cool-roof pigments that maintain a specific color palette while bouncing solar heat away from the living space.
  • Synthetic Composites: Advanced polymers are molded to look like stone or wood, providing a lightweight option for homes that cannot support the weight of natural slate.
  • Integrated Solar Options: Modern solar shingles replace traditional panels, allowing the house to generate power without disrupting the roofline.

FAQ’s

What is the most durable roofing material that still looks modern?

Metal roofing, specifically standing seam panels, offers the best mix of modern aesthetics and extreme durability because it lasts over fifty years and features clean, hidden fasteners.

How does roof color affect the temperature inside a home?

Darker roofs absorb more thermal energy from the sun, which can increase cooling costs in the summer, while lighter or reflective roofs bounce heat away to keep the interior cooler.

Can a roof be both lightweight and look like heavy stone?

Synthetic slate and composite shingles are designed to mimic the appearance of heavy stone or clay while weighing significantly less, making them suitable for standard home frames.

Why is ventilation important for a roof’s appearance?

Proper airflow prevents heat and moisture from damaging the shingles or causing the wood deck to warp, which keeps the roof surface flat and visually appealing over time.
